Examples of Conditions that May Delay Surgery Include: Pneumonia or bronchitis within a month before surgery. Stomach virus or flu. Fever. Asthma attack or wheezing within two weeks before surgery.

Cough: A significant, nagging cough most likely will require us to reschedule most surgical procedures, especially if they're performed using a general anesthetic. General anesthesia can irritate the airway and make a cough worse.
